action |
something that is done for a specific purpose. |
belt |
a piece of cloth, leather, or other material that you wear around the waist. |
bookcase |
a set of shelves for holding books. |
carpenter |
a person who builds or repairs houses and other things made of wood. |
clue |
something that helps to solve a problem or mystery. |
gardener |
a person whose job is taking care of plants, lawns, and the like. |
gown |
a dress worn on special occasions. |
innocent |
free from evil or knowledge of evil. |
joke |
a short story with a funny ending that is told to make people laugh. |
leave1 |
to go away from a place. |
marry |
to become someone's husband or wife according to the law. |
rid |
to cause things that are not wanted to go away. |
scrape |
to rub with something sharp or rough. |
shell |
a hard outer covering that an animal, especially a sea animal, has made to protect itself. |
string |
a thin rope. |
